Dollar up worksheets are a valuable tool for teaching individuals with disabilities how to effectively manage money. These worksheets help students understand the concept of rounding up to the nearest dollar when making purchases, which is a crucial skill for budgeting and financial independence.
By using dollar up worksheets, educators can provide hands-on practice for students to learn how to round up amounts to the nearest dollar when making purchases. This skill helps students avoid overspending and ensures they have enough money for their desired purchases.
One of the key benefits of dollar up worksheets is that they can be tailored to suit the individual needs and abilities of each student. Educators can create worksheets that cater to different skill levels, making it easier for students to grasp the concept and apply it in real-life situations.
Furthermore, dollar up worksheets can also be used to teach students how to calculate change and manage their finances effectively. By practicing rounding up to the nearest dollar, students can develop a better understanding of budgeting and financial planning.
